Louisville Coach Implies Alabama Tampered With Team’s WR Transfer

MIKE MCDANIEL     9 HOURS AGO

With college football hitting unprecedented roster turnover in the new age of NIL legislation and transfers without restrictions, rumors and allegations of tampering are at an all-time high.

And for one ACC school, there are questions as to whether or not a departed wide receiver was tampered with by the University of Alabama.

Louisville wide receiver Tyler Harrell entered the transfer portal in April, and upon his entry into the portal, 247Sports reported that he would head to Tuscaloosa.

According to a report from 247Sports, Louisville coach Scott Satterfield believes that tampering occurred behind the scenes in the case of his former wide receiver Harrell.

“I think it’s not only him, it’s happened before here. Last year, we had a few guys that jumped into the portal and the next day they’re announcing where they’re going. You can look at that and know that something went on before they were in the portal,” Satterfield said.

Allegations of tampering are not just happening at Louisville. Pittsburgh coach Pat Narduzzi reportedly called new USC coach Lincoln Riley to “express his displeasure” regarding rumors that Biletnikoff winner Jordan Addison was entering the portal to leave Pittsburgh in favor of a lucrative NIL deal with Riley and the Trojans.

College football is in the middle of unprecedented times, where there are few regulations regarding NIL, the transfer portal and the implications of potential tampering across the sport. Which direction the sport heads next is anybody’s guess.

Lede buried.  Go to 5:00 in for the payoff.   I agree with Saban that NIL is being misused.  But I’d prefer to let it be a free for all and have dumb rich guys waste their money.  When half of Aggie’s (and other schools’) class has transferred in 2 years, the bagmen are going to be feeling pretty stupid.  
 

My hope is that these collectives burn out and the NIL does what it is supposed to do for players that can find gigs.   There is ROI for both sides having Bijan do a Covert commercial or Quinn getting the cover of a video game.   But giving money to players to come to a school under the guise of NIL is not sustainable long term.  Particularly since it is more or less legal now. A lot of money is going to get blown for no payoff and a lot of bagmen are going to be feel really dumb when these kids, who are pretty smart and seem to get the game, start transferring, or threaten to transfer, for more money.
